Oklahoma Highway Patrol's decision to shift troopers from metro areas to rural regions has drawn both criticism and support from law enforcement leaders across the state.
Del City Police Chief Lloyd Berger said OHP's decision to reshuffle troopers to different parts of the state is going to have a ripple effect on his department.
